Output d4a8834ed54f6c81ddf6ef75dff8ce5c0e31661aff7d9eb15c9faecedea7325e:0

value
943099365
script pubkey
OP_0 OP_PUSHBYTES_20 ece1a0024130c33b295dc54b7cc88201baa5fdcb
address
tb1qans6qqjpxrpnk22ac49hejyzqxa2tlwtehyn3r
transaction
d4a8834ed54f6c81ddf6ef75dff8ce5c0e31661aff7d9eb15c9faecedea7325e
confirmations
105827
spent
true